Ziapin 2 is a membrane potential modulator and an intracellular membrane photoactuator. Ziapin 2 binds to the bacterial plasma membrane, and upon embedding into the lipid bilayer, undergoes trans-cis isomerization under 470 nm light irradiation, which triggers membrane potential hyperpolarization and induces the opening of ion channels on bacterial cell membranes. Through interactions with lipids, Ziapin 2 increases the overall flexibility of the lipid bilayer. Ziapin 2 can form photosensitive transmembrane dimers to trigger cellular signal transduction. Ziapin 2 is applicable to the research and regulation of bacterial electrical signal transduction and the regulation of membrane physical properties[1][2].
